Former D1 swimmer here! Once your eyes pass the T on the bottom of the pool get ready to flip, keep your face looking down and use your eyes to find the wall by looking up. Also you can practice turns by doing a forward roll on the ground close to a wall and then landing with your feet on the wall. Your legs should be at 90° with your feet on the wall and your back on the ground. You can throw you hands and arms into streamline over your head too if you’re feeling fancy.

A tip for flip turns, start by going slow into the wall, when you fingers touch the wall flip then. Once you get the flow down, stop touching the wall and flip. It will start to feel natural and you won’t have to touch then flip anymore, you will just learn to flip.
